Transaction 990f0b503b0826848a48645812baac58b12d0beefa6f231f98635e6265428658
1 Input
1 Output
-
990f0b503b0826848a48645812baac58b12d0beefa6f231f98635e6265428658:0
- value
- 38188136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ce54e6b8fc632a3af5e92d1a64ef3918a7cd2660 OP_EQUAL
- address
- 3LVzq6yQzXz9jmokPMuy28AxgZjMT54R9a